We stayed at the Tanjung Rhu Resort http://www.tanjungrhu.com.my/index.htm which is like a hotel inside the Eden Project; it has a jungle feel about it with hundreds of birds, flowers and tropical plants. The hotel has 137 bedrooms, many pools, a la carte restaurants and a gorgeous Spa! It is situated on a huge stretch of private beach - perfect for sailing and snorkelling. Le Tour de Langkawi 2007 celebrates it’s 12th year race is an annual cycling race which is held in Malaysia, it attracts high profile teams and riders from the top international professional cycling field. It is a ten day event which starts in Langkawi and finishes in central Kuala Lumpur.
